java基本數(shù)據(jù)類型長度(java數(shù)據(jù)類型長度為什么是固定的)
1、java的基本數(shù)據(jù)類型有八種,如下所示一四種整數(shù)類型byteshortintlong1byte8 位,用于表示最小數(shù)據(jù)單位2short16 位,很少用3int32 位,最常用4long64 位,次常用二兩種浮點(diǎn);Java定義了8個(gè)簡單的數(shù)據(jù)類型字節(jié)型byte,短整型short,整型int,長整型 long,字符型char,浮點(diǎn)型 float,雙精度型double,布爾型 booleanbyte 1字節(jié),short 2字節(jié),char 2字節(jié);整數(shù)類型byte字節(jié)占用 1字節(jié) 8位,用來表達(dá)最小的數(shù)據(jù)單位,儲(chǔ)存數(shù)據(jù)長度為 正負(fù) 127short字節(jié)占用 2字節(jié) 16位,儲(chǔ)存數(shù)值長度為 int字節(jié)占用 4字節(jié) 32位,最為常用的整數(shù)類型,儲(chǔ)存長度為;1四種整數(shù)類型byteshortintlong byte8 位,用于表示最小數(shù)據(jù)單位,如文件中數(shù)據(jù),128~127 short16 位,很少用, int32 位最常用,2^311~2^31 21 億 lo;一整數(shù)類型byteshortintlong都是表示整數(shù)的,只不過他們的取值范圍不一樣1bytebyte數(shù)據(jù)類型是8位有符號(hào)的,以二進(jìn)制補(bǔ)碼表示的整數(shù)256個(gè)數(shù)字,占1字節(jié)最小值是1282^7最大值是127。
2、答案B Java的基本數(shù)據(jù)類型的字長是與平臺(tái)無關(guān)的,int型字長為32;java的基本數(shù)據(jù)類型有1布爾型boolean取值范圍True 或 False 2字節(jié)型byte取值范圍0 255 3短整型short取值范圍 4整型int取值范圍2,147,483,648 ~ 2,147,483;在Java中一共有8種基本數(shù)據(jù)類型,其中有4種整型,2種浮點(diǎn)類型,1種用于表示Unicode編碼的字符單元的字符類型和1種用于表示真值的boolean類型一個(gè)字節(jié)等于8個(gè)bit,java是跟平臺(tái)無關(guān)的1整型其中byteshortint;Java語言提供了八種基本類型六種數(shù)字類型四個(gè)整數(shù)型,兩個(gè)浮點(diǎn)型,一種字符類型,還有一種布爾型 1整數(shù)包括int,short,byte,long 2浮點(diǎn)型float,double 3字符char 4布爾boolean 擴(kuò)展Java是一門;其中的大小也就是長度的位,電腦保存數(shù)據(jù)是保存二進(jìn)制“01”數(shù)據(jù),一個(gè)0或1占一位,整型int數(shù)據(jù)長度32位,就是32個(gè)二進(jìn)制數(shù)字它能表示的數(shù)字就是值為 2^312^311。
3、JAVA中一共有八種基本數(shù)據(jù)類型,分別是byteshortintlongfloatdoublecharboolean1byte8位,最大存儲(chǔ)數(shù)據(jù)量是255,存放的數(shù)據(jù)范圍是,數(shù)據(jù)范圍是;java基本數(shù)據(jù)類型就8種,記住就好了除了這些都是引用型的了java四類八種基本數(shù)據(jù)類型 第一類整型 byte short int long 第二類浮點(diǎn)型 float double 第三類邏輯型 boolean它只有兩個(gè)值可取true false第四類;一常見的基本的數(shù)據(jù)類型 1byte 字節(jié)類型 占1字節(jié),1個(gè)字節(jié)8位如123,100 范圍128~1272^7~2^712short 短整型 占2字節(jié) 16位 如123,456 范圍2^15~2^1513int 整型。
4、Java的基礎(chǔ)類型長度是固定的,都是4字節(jié)Java程序不是直接運(yùn)行在本地操作系統(tǒng)上,而是運(yùn)行在JVM上,JVM將class程序不同的操作系統(tǒng)下的基礎(chǔ)類型長度固定希望對(duì)你有用;得到的是2字節(jié)綜上,c=#39a#39在內(nèi)存中確實(shí)只占1字節(jié),但這不意味著String s=quotabcquot在內(nèi)存中只占3字節(jié)應(yīng)該這么說,String s=quotabcquot至少在內(nèi)存中占3字節(jié)這是因?yàn)閏har是基本數(shù)據(jù)類型,而String確是對(duì)象類型;boolean falsetrue理論上占用1bit,18字節(jié),實(shí)際處理按1byte處理JAVA是采用Unicode編碼每一個(gè)字節(jié)占8位你電腦系統(tǒng)應(yīng)該是32位系統(tǒng),這樣每個(gè)int就是4個(gè)字節(jié) 其中一個(gè)字節(jié)由8個(gè)二進(jìn)制位組成 Java一共有8種基本數(shù)據(jù)。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由飛速云SEO網(wǎng)絡(luò)優(yōu)化推廣發(fā)布,如需轉(zhuǎn)載請(qǐng)注明出處。